This page describes how to configure the display of AWS billing data for standard accounts.
For details of how to display Amazon billing data for standard accounts for billing only,
see Add a customer AWS account for billing only .For details of how to configure reseller accounts, see Display Amazon billing data .
The billing data will display on the multi-cloud platform in Home view on the default Hybrid Billing dashboard in the Last bills and Estimated bill widgets.
See Hybrid in the billing dashboards section.
Create a cost and usage report in AWS
As you work through these steps, note the values you configure so that you can later register them in Abiquo with enterprise properties.
Create an S3 bucket, with a name such as
costandusagebillingreport
Within the bucket, create a folder where AWS will store your reports. Give it the name of your report, such as
costandusagereport
If your Abiquo AWS user does not already have an S3 policy for using volumes, assign a policy to allow readonly access to S3 storage
On the AWS Billing console, select the Activate IAM access setting.
See https://docs.aws.amazon.com/awsaccountbilling/latest/aboutv2/control-access-billing.htmlGo to Cost & Usage Reports
Enter the Report name, then click Next
Click Configure and select the S3 bucket. Click Next, then select I have configured that this policy is correct.
By default, Amazon will put the reports in a folder with the name format
/report-name/date-range/
. Note this value to enter it as theamazon_bucket_prefix
in Abiquo.Click Next
Review your configuration and check that the following parameters are set.
bucket name
path (folder/subfolder)
time detail:
Hourly
GZ
orZIP
format
The AWS account with credentials to use in Abiquo should have pricing and billing permissions.
See https://abiquo.atlassian.net/wiki/spaces/doc/pages/311370749/Obtain+AWS+credentials#Standard-pricing-and-billing-credentials
Configure standard Amazon accounts
To configure standard Amazon accounts to display billing in Abiquo, do these steps.
In Abiquo, edit the Enterprise and go to Credentials
On the Pricing tab, check or enter the AWS credentials for pricing and billing
Go to Properties.
Enter the properties with values as described here:
amazon_bucket
:bucket_name
amazon_bucket_region
: code for the AWS region of the bucket, such asus-east-1
amazon_report_name
: amazon_bucket/amazon_bucket_prefix/amazon_report_name
/file.csvamazon_bucket_prefix
: amazon_bucket/amazon_bucket_prefix
/amazon_report_name/file.csvamazon_billing_compress_format
:ZIP
orGZ
amazon_mpa
: set todedicated
orno
to use blended costs; if not present orshared
, use unblended costs
Save the enterprise.